The reason why this debate might die a natural death is that Jamal Musiala is in a better position to win individual laurels in the future than Gavi and Pedri. Here is why.
Musiala plays further up the pitch where he will score a lot of goals and record more assists than Pedri and Gavi.
This season, Musiala has 9 goals and 8 assists in the Bundesliga and Champions League which is more than Pedri (3 goals and 0 assists) and Gavi ( 0 goals and 1assist) combined.
The reason why Lionel Messi and Cristiano Ronaldo are regarded as two of the greatest players ever is because of their impact in the final third with the litany of goals they have scored in their respective careers.
One of the reasons why players like Ronaldinho and Zinedine Zidane are not in the conversation of the greatest players of all time is that they didn’t score as much as Messi and Ronaldo have.
Pedri and Gavi might have won the Golden ball award without scoring much, but the Balon D’or is different.
Yes, Modric won the Balon D’or without scoring a dozen of goals but we all know his case was an extremely special circumstance.
This is not to say Musiala will win the Balon D’or but to point out the fact that if the career of these three players continues this way, the German wonder kid would be in a better place than the Spanish wonder kids to win individual awards in the future and would end any debate regarding him and Gavi-Pedri.
Unless Pedri and Gavi start scoring multiple goals and recording assists, Musiala will stand a better chance to win individual accolades in the future.
